Robotics is a cross-disciplinary field that involves the design, construction, operation, and application of robots. Robotics efforts aim to produce machines that can aid and support people. Robotics is the convergence of science, engineering, and technology that generate machines, known as robots, which mimic or replace human activities. Machine learning and robotics converge in a domain referred to as robot learning. Robot learning involves examining methods that allow a robot to get new knowledge or abilities by utilizing ML algorithms. There are several types of robotics such as Mechanical Construction, Electrical Components, and Software Programs. Some robots are designed in advance to carry out designated functions, specifying they work in a regulated setting where they execute straightforward, repetitive tasks such as a robotic arm on a car production line. Various types of robot components include control systems, sensors, actuators, power supplies, and end effectors. Robots are preconfigured to execute specific task. The progress of AI significantly impacts the future of robotics. AI can integrate with robotics to create digital twins and develop simulations that help businesses to increase their workflows. Robotic process automation could displace human workers, particularly those lacking the ability to adjust to an evolving job environment. Manufacturing robots are able to put together products, categorize items, execute welding tasks, and apply paint to objects. They can also be used to repair and service various machines in a factory or warehouse. The uses and potentials for robotics are limitless, with more than 12 million robotic units globally in 2020. The sector is set to keep expanding in the next few years, with 88% of companies intending to incorporate robotic automation into their systems. Presently industrial robots, along with various other kinds of robots, are utilized to execute repetitive tasks. They may appear as a robotic arm, a collaborative robot (cobot), a robotic exoskeleton, or humanoid robots.
